Hazel E Dublinske 1905 - 1961

Hazel E Dublinske was born on August 12, 1905, and died at age 55 years old on June 18, 1961. Hazel Dublinske was buried at Rock Island National Cemetery Section M Site 690 Bldg 118 - Rock Island Arsenal, in Rock Island, Il. In 1905, in the year that Hazel E Dublinske was born, the Niagara Falls conference was held in Fort Erie, Ontario. Led by W.E.B. Du Bois and William Monroe Trotter, a group of African-American men met in opposition to racial segregation and disenfranchisement. Booker T. Washington had been calling for policies of accommodation and conciliation and these two men, along with the others who attended the conference, felt that this was accomplishing nothing. The group was the precursor to the NAACP.

In 1910, when she was merely 5 years old, Halley's comet, which returns past the earth every 75 - 76 years was observed photographically for the first time. Two fortuitous events occurred - photography had been invented since the last time the comet had passed and the comet was relatively close. There was panic because one astronomer claimed that the gas from its tail "would impregnate the atmosphere and possibly snuff out all life on the planet." People bought gas masks, "anti-comet pills" and "anti-comet umbrellas".
